Salisbury See Off Enfield Town with Clinical 2-0 Home Victory
Salisbury produced a confident performance at The Raymond McEnhill Stadium, dispatching Enfield Town 2-0 in this National League South encounter. The hosts struck in each half, first breaking the deadlock in the 22nd minute before doubling their advantage just after the hour mark. Enfield Town, despite their efforts, were unable to find a response, leaving Salisbury to celebrate a deserved three points. The match was notable for its sporting spirit, with neither side receiving a single booking.
